#B3D189 Color
#B3D189 is rgb(179, 209, 137) in RGB, hsl(85, 44%, 68%) in HSL, and about cmyk(14%, 0%, 34%, 18%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Olivine (#9AB973),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.78.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#B3D189 Channel Values
How #B3D189 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 179 · G 209 · B 137 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 85° · S 44% · L 68%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 85° · S 34% · V 82%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 14% · M 0% · Y 34% · K 18%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.69:1 vs white · 12.4: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#B3D189 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#B3D189?
#B3D189 is a light green — rgb(179, 209, 137) in RGB and hsl(85, 44%, 68%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Olivine (#9AB973),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.78.
What is the RGB value of #B3D189?
#B3D189 is rgb(179, 209, 137) — red 179, green 209, and blue 137 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#B3D189?
#B3D189 converts to approximately cmyk(14%, 0%, 34%, 18%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#B3D189 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#B3D189 scores 1.69:1 against white and 12.4: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#B3D189 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#B3D189 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kkhaki (#BDB76B) at a CIE76 distance of 16.73, which is visibly different.
